Responsibilities

Oversee all kitchen operations, including food preparation, quality control, and recipe adherence

Train, coach, and develop kitchen team members to maintain high performance and consistency

Ensure proper food safety, sanitation standards, and compliance with health regulations

Manage inventory, ordering, and waste to control food costs

Maintain BOH equipment, organization, and cleanliness

Lead by example with strong communication, professionalism, and teamwork

Collaborate with the management team to ensure smooth restaurant-wide operations

Support a positive, productive work environment while upholding Jinya’s brand standards

Troubleshoot operational challenges and remain calm under pressure

Qualifications

Previous experience as a Kitchen Manager, BOH Supervisor, or equivalent leadership role

Strong understanding of food safety, kitchen operations, and inventory management

Proven ability to train, motivate, and lead a diverse team

Excellent problem-solving and organizational skills

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, high-volume environment

Consistent, reliable, and committed to delivering exceptional quality
